[02-07-2025] Woman and Dog Killed, Three Injured After Multi-Car Crash on 405 Freeway Near WestwoodA 72-year-old woman and a dog were killed, while three others sustained injuries in a multi-car crash in Westwood, Los Angeles on Friday, February 7, 2025.

According to the California Highway Patrol, the crash occurred at approximately 6:45 p.m. on the northbound 405 Freeway near Wilshire Boulevard. 

Firefighters arrived at the scene and extricated a trapped individual from a vehicle. 

Authorities confirmed that 72-year-old Margaret J. and a dog died in the collision. Two people were critically injured, while a 60-year-old woman was reported to be in fair condition.

Firefighters reported that another dog initially ran onto the freeway but was later captured by authorities.

The CHP is investigating the cause of the crash.
